**INV-1187 — Invoice PDFs clip long line items**

So the Quillbook invoice renderer wraps line-item descriptions fine on screen, but the PDF export clips anything past two lines — customers with verbose SKU names get truncated totals pushed off the page. Root cause looks like the fixed row height in the table layout helper; future maintainers, resist the urge to just bump the constant, because receipts reuse the same helper. Repro needs a description over ~140 chars. The renderer build that exhibits this is identified by the token below.

session token of tajef-bageg = htk21_5d90d574934f3ccae6437

Each pod in the Halyard fleet now runs a sidecar that aggregates counters and histograms locally before forwarding them upstream, cutting scrape volume by roughly 80%. Add the sidecar to the pod spec before removing the direct exporter, and run both in parallel for one full rollout window so dashboards can be cross-checked. Pay particular attention to the flush interval: too short negates the batching benefit, too long risks data loss on eviction. The sidecar reads the following configuration at startup.

settings of fafog-haduf:
ZORIX_PIN=4648
ZORIX_METRICS_HOST=metrics.zorix.paliqsys.corp
ZORIX_LOG_LEVEL=info
ZORIX_TENANT=druix

Runbook: Sensor drift, Verdanta greenhouse controller. If humidity readings diverge >4% between paired probes, the Thornquist calibrator flags drift and freezes actuator output. Do not restart the controller; recalibrate the suspect probe first, then clear the flag. Reviewers: verify drift thresholds match the calibration spec. Full procedure and threshold table are on the internal page here.

dashboard of yafog-fajof = https://jira.tolvaqsys.internal/pages/pages/projects/49fe21c4